Wagering Requirements: The Hidden Cost of Free Spins

Every operator sets their own rules. Some are generous, others are punishing. A wagering requirement of 40x on a £100 bonus means you need to stake £4,000 before you can withdraw anything. That’s a tall order for a casual player. We saw Sun Vegas offering a 100% deposit match up to £100 plus 100 free spins, but the wagering window is only 3 days. That is incredibly tight. If you miss the deadline, the bonus and any winnings vanish.

On the flip side, 888 Casino gives you 90 days to clear a 10x wagering requirement on their deposit match bonus. That is far more reasonable. The cap on winnings is £100, which limits the upside, but the extended timeframe makes it achievable for most players. We would recommend checking the “wagering days” clause before committing to any offer.

>A Quick Checklist for Evaluating Offers

  • Check the wagering multiplier (x30 to x40 is standard; lower is better)
  • Look at the time limit (3 days is risky; 30 to 90 days is safe)
  • Confirm whether PayPal, Neteller, or Skrill deposits qualify
  • Note the maximum win cap (some offers cap your winnings at £30 to £100)
  • See if the free spins are on a single slot or a selection

>Are Neteller deposits faster than debit cards?

In our tests, e-wallet deposits were instant at all operators. Debit card deposits were also instant, but withdrawals to cards took 1 to 3 business days. Neteller withdrawals completed in under 24 hours at most sites.

>Do all UK casinos accept Neteller?

Not all. Some operators exclude e-wallets from bonus eligibility. For example, Party Casino excludes Neteller, PayPal, and Skrill from their welcome offer. Always check the terms before depositing.
